Friday, April 9, 2010 at Darlington High School: Results
Rain, snow, and cold weather pushed the Darlington Invitational to Friday. Friday turned out to be an ideal day for a track meet as teams from Benton, Blackhawk, Galena [IL], Monticello, Pecatonica-Argyle, River Ridge, Shullsburg, Southwestern, and Stockton [IL] competed at Darlington. No team scores were kept. Teams were allowed an unlimited number of entrants in each event. Schools at Darlington were D3.
Rachel Rygh [above left, Black Hawk] won the 100m and 200m dash events. Kara Krahenbuhl [above center, Darlington] was third in the 100m dash while Alyssa Iserman [above right, Southwestern] was fifth.
Kelsey Bernet [left] from Monticello won the 1600m and 3200m races.

High jump winner Brittany Bradley [left, River Ridge] won with a height of 5' 00. Bradley also won the LJ event. Bradley also ran in two relays and was voted Female Athlete of the Darlington Invitational.
